Network Connection with LAN

• You can use a disc which offers BD-Live function by connecting the unit to the Internet.
(For BD-Live information, please refer to page 29.)
Telecommunications
equipment (modem, etc.)
Internet
No supplied cables are used in this connection:
Please purchase the necessary cables at your local store.
Note
• After connecting a LAN cable, set up necessary network settings.
(For the network setup, refer to "Network Connection" on page 42.)
• Do not insert any cable other than a LAN cable to the LAN terminal to avoid damaging the unit.
• If your telecommunications equipment (modem, etc.) does not have broadband router functions, connect a
broadband router.
• If your telecommunications equipment (modem, etc.) has broadband router functions but there is no vacant port,
use a hub.
• For a broadband router, use a router which supports 10BASE-T / 100BASE-TX.
• Do not connect your PC directly to the LAN terminal of this unit.
